The Impact of Temperature on Paint Application



When you're planning a commercial external paint project, the temperature can dramatically impact just how well the paint adheres and dries.

Ideally, you intend to repaint when temperature levels vary between 50 ° F and 85 ° F. If it's also cool, the paint might not cure properly, resulting in problems like peeling or cracking.

On the flip side, if it's also warm, the paint can dry too swiftly, avoiding correct attachment and causing an uneven finish.

You should likewise think about the time of day; early morning or late afternoon offers cooler temperature levels, which can be extra desirable.

Moisture and Its Effect on Drying Times



Temperature level isn't the only ecological factor that affects your commercial outside paint task; moisture plays a substantial duty as well. High moisture degrees can reduce drying times significantly, influencing the overall high quality of your paint job.



When the air is filled with dampness, the paint takes longer to cure, which can bring about issues like poor adhesion and a higher threat of mold development. If you're painting on a particularly moist day, be planned for prolonged wait times between coats.

It's important to keep track of neighborhood climate condition and strategy appropriately. Ideally, go for humidity degrees between 40% and 70% for ideal drying.

Keeping these consider mind guarantees your project remains on track and supplies an enduring finish.

Best Seasons for Commercial Outside Painting Projects



What's the very best season for your commercial outside painting tasks?

Spring and early loss are normally your best choices. During these seasons, temperatures are light, and moisture levels are commonly lower, developing perfect problems for paint application and drying.

Prevent summertime's intense heat, which can trigger paint to dry too swiftly, leading to inadequate bond and coating. Similarly, winter months's cool temperatures can hinder appropriate drying out and treating, running the risk of the long life of your paint work.

Go for days with temperature levels in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F for ideal results. Keep in mind to examine the neighborhood weather prediction for rainfall, as wet conditions can ruin your task.

Planning around these elements guarantees your paint project runs efficiently and lasts longer.
